Eaton's Crouse-Hinds Business is designer and manufacturer of alarm, signal, control and notification equipment since 1975.

Eaton acquired Cooper Industries plc in late 2012.

Eaton's Crouse-Hinds Business integrates a comprehensive line of electrical and instrumentation products with expert support, industry insights and local availability, engineering safety and productivity in the most demanding industrial and commercial environments worldwide.

The products specifically designed for harsh environmental conditions and where there is a risk of explosion due to the presence of flammable atmospheres both onshore and offshore.

Based at Sutton in Ashfield, Nottingham, Cooper MEDC is designer and manufacturer of alarm, signal, control and notification equipment used in harsh environmental conditions.

The plant employs around 190 people.

  • What You’ll Do
  • Maintenance
  • Implements Repair and maintain plant manufacturing equipment for all breakdowns
  • Undertake routine Maintenance duties as required
  • Liaise with sub-contract toolmakers and service providers to ensure timely support for breakdown and tooling issues
  • Manage maintenance records for any maintenance undertaken
  • Implement and maintain planned maintenance programme ensuring this is balanced with capacity planning and fulfils all EHS requirements.
  • Management of contractors to Eaton's requirements for the repair to plant equipment to reduce reactive costs whilst increasing utilisation of machinary to meet 100% Flex/Productivity target.
  • Facilities
  • Provide effective Facility Management services across site and facilities and equipment to include construction, infrastructure repair and maintain.
  • Responsible for the general upkeep and maintenance of buildings to ensure that they meet health and safety standards and also the legal requirements.
  • Liaise with Sub-contractors related to facility maintenance such as air conditioning, water, electricity, fabric of the building and roofing.
  • Accountable for services such as cleaning, security, heating and air conditioning, to make sure the surrounding environment is in a suitable condition to work.
  • Maintain energy use, manage reductions where possible
  • Maintain water use, manage reductions where possible
  • Plant & Equipment
  • Establish maintenance programs for all plant & equipment
  • Arrange external services and repairs where required
  • Maintain and develop the critical spares list and spares for all Plant & Equipment
  • Manage Critical machine review/
  • Manage Maintenance/capacity planning
  • MESH
  • Support Health and safety manager in control and operation of MESH functions.
  • Work closely with EHS & CI Departments, Championing/Leading EHS Elements to include but not limited to Contractor Control, Security, Energy Usage, Emergency Protection Systems, Machine Guarding and working at height.
  • Support risk assessments at the location to identify critical EHS hazards and aspects. Carry out IH, environmental measurement and manage results.
  • Support and promotes zero incident EHS culture throughout site.
  • Support EHS engagement through EHS teams and committees needed to accomplish the established targets and objectives for the year.
  • Work with EHS leader and MESH element champions to complete an annual evaluation of compliance for EHS country, state, and local regulations.
  • Support efforts for third party recognition for programs that establish the site and Eaton’s EHS program as world class.
  • Other
  • Identify and implement improvements in line with the Eaton Lean System (ELS)
  • Maintain Standard work instructions applicable to Eaton lean system and TPM
  • Support project managers in new product introduction i. e. new machine MOC, training and implementation.
  • Capex- Create and manage Capex projects from Ranking, justification, MESH and introduction both facility and production/process
  • Responsible for ensuring timely closure and/or escalation of Maintenance Tickets.
